Hirado vs Quintero Climate & Distance Between

Chile flag
  • The distance between Hirado, Japan and Quintero, Chile is approximately 18,069 km or 11,228 mi.
  • To reach Hirado in this distance one would set out from Quintero bearing 276.8° or W and follow the great circles arc to approach Hirado bearing 274.8° or W .
  • Hirado is in or near the warm temperate wet forest biome whereas Quintero is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 3 °C (5.4°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 14 °C (25.2°F) more in Hirado.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1738.8 mm (68.5 in) more which is equivalent to 1738.8 l/m² (42.67 US gal/ft²) or 17,388,000 l/ha (1,858,893 US gal/ac) more. About 6 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0.4° higher in Hirado than in Quintero.
  • Relative humidity levels are 12.6%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 0.6°C (1°F) higher.
